What are some notable 'Joker kills Robin' graphic novels?

1 answer
2024-11-10 20:30

There's also 'Batman: Under the Red Hood' which, while not directly about the initial 'Joker kills Robin' event, still touches on the aftermath. It shows how the death of Robin haunts Batman and how it affects the actions of other characters in the Batman universe. It also gives more insight into the Joker's psyche and his role in Robin's death.

What are the best Batman Joker graphic novels?

2 answers
2024-12-09 18:11

One of the best is 'The Killing Joke'. It delves deep into the relationship between Batman and the Joker. It shows the Joker's origin story in a way that's both tragic and terrifying, and the art is superb. It really sets the tone for their complex relationship in the Batman universe.
